  1. When was the word ‘Integrity’ added to the Preamble of our Constitution?

(a) Since adoption
(b) With 73rd amendment in 1992
(c) With 14th amendment
(d) With 42nd amendment in 1976
Ans. d

  1. Which of the following is known as ‘Mini Constitution’?

(a) 42nd Amendment
(b) 44th Amendment
(c) 52nd Amendment
(d) 73rd Amendment
Ans. a

  1. Right to property is now a

(a) Fundamental right
(b) Constitutional right
(c) Both fundamental and constitutional right
(d) Neither fundamental nor constitutional right
Ans. b

  1. Fundamental Duties were added to the Indian constitution on the recommendations of

(a) G.M. Khanna Committee
(b) Kakodar Committee
(c) Swaran Singh Committee
(d) Kelkar Committee
Ans. c
